About Laura Camoni
Laura Camoni is a scholar working on Virology, Infectious Diseases and Epidemiology, having authored 56 papers that have together received 597 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include HIV/AIDS Research and Interventions (25 papers), HIV, Drug Use, Sexual Risk (24 papers) and HIV Research and Treatment (16 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Virology (155 citations), Infectious Diseases (377 citations) and Epidemiology (371 citations). Laura Camoni has collaborated with scholars based in Italy, Armenia and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Barbara Suligoi, Vincenza Règine, Maria Cristina Salfa, Mariangela Raimondo, Giovanni Rezza, Patrizio Pezzotti, Stefano Boros, Antonella Zucchetto, Diego Serraino and Luigino Dal Maso.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and Neuroscience & Biobehavioral Reviews.
